WordPress Database-optimalisatie: wp_options-tabel opschonen voor TTFB
WordPress-site sneller maken en je bezoekers een betere ervaring bieden, is database-optimalisatie een cruciale stap. Vooral het opschonen van de wp_options-tabel kan de TTFB (Time To First Byte)-tijd van je site aanzienlijk verbeteren. In dit artikel ontdek je gedetailleerd de rol van de wp_options-tabel in de WordPress-prestaties, waarom TTFB belangrijk is en hoe je de snelheid van je site kunt verhogen door deze tabel te optimaliseren.
Het effect van de wp_options-tabel op WordPress-prestaties en TTFB begrijpen
In de werking van WordPress is de wp_options-tabel een fundamentele bouwsteen. Deze tabel slaat diverse instellingen en configuratiegegevens op die door de WordPress-kern, plugins en thema's worden gebruikt. Veel data die nodig is voor een correcte werking van je site wordt hier opgeslagen en bij elke paginalading wordt deze tabel geraadpleegd. Na verloop van tijd kan deze tabel echter vol raken met onnodige of tijdelijke gegevens. Dit leidt tot langere querytijden en overmatig gebruik van systeembronnen.
TTFB (Time To First Byte) verwijst naar de tijd die een webpagina nodig heeft om het eerste byte-antwoord van de server te ontvangen. TTFB is een cruciale prestatie-indicator voor gebruikerservaring en SEO. Een lage TTFB creëert de indruk dat je pagina snel laadt en helpt je betere posities in zoekmachines te behalen. Omgekeerd geeft een hoge TTFB de indruk dat je site traag is en kan dit je ranking negatief beïnvloeden.
Het opzwellen van de wp_options-tabel, oftewel het bloated raken, ontstaat vooral door de ophoping van onnodige data zoals autoloaded options (automatisch geladen opties), transient data (tijdelijke data) en orphaned entries (verweesde vermeldingen). Autoloaded options worden bij elke paginaverzoek automatisch geladen en een te grote hoeveelheid hiervan verhoogt direct de querytijden. Transient data wordt meestal gebruikt voor tijdelijke prestatieverbeteringen, maar als deze niet worden verwijderd nadat ze verlopen zijn, veroorzaken ze onnodige belasting in de database. Orphaned entries zijn verouderde of door plugins achtergelaten onnodige records die niet langer worden gebruikt.
Dit soort database-opzwelling leidt tot langere responstijden van queries en heeft een negatieve invloed op de algehele WordPress-prestaties. Uiteindelijk stijgt de TTFB, kunnen bezoekers ongeduldig worden terwijl ze wachten op het laden van de pagina en kunnen zoekmachines je site als traag beoordelen.
Database-optimalisatie is een van de meest effectieve methoden om deze problemen op te lossen. Vooral het opschonen en regelmatig onderhouden van de wp_options-tabel verhoogt de snelheid en efficiëntie van je WordPress-site. Hierdoor verbeteren niet alleen de TTFB, maar ook de algemene laadtijden van pagina's en de gebruikerservaring. Dit proces is niet alleen een technische vereiste, maar ook een belangrijk onderdeel van je SEO-strategie.
Voor het verbeteren van de prestaties is het belangrijk om de wp_options-tabel regelmatig te monitoren en te optimaliseren, zodat de duurzaamheid van je WordPress-site gewaarborgd blijft. Met de juiste tools en methoden om deze tabel op te schonen, kun je zowel je serverbronnen efficiënter gebruiken als je bezoekers een snelle site-ervaring bieden. Zo kun je je onderscheiden in de competitieve digitale wereld.

Het identificeren en diagnosticeren van wp_options-tabelproblemen die TTFB vertragen
Het opsporen van problemen in de wp_options-tabel is de eerste en belangrijkste stap om de WordPress-prestaties te verbeteren. Er zijn verschillende methoden om de grootte van deze tabel en het volume van automatisch geladen (autoloaded) gegevens te controleren. Een van de meest gebruikte tools is phpMyAdmin, dat vaak beschikbaar is in het hosting controlepaneel. Via phpMyAdmin kun je de wp_options-tabel selecteren, de tabelgrootte bekijken en nagaan welke opties als autoload zijn gemarkeerd.
SQL-query's voor het controleren van wp_options-grootte en autoloaded data
Om te zien welke gegevens in de wp_options-tabel als autoload zijn ingesteld en hoeveel ruimte ze innemen, kunnen de volgende SQL-query's worden gebruikt:
SELECT option_name, LENGTH(option_value) AS option_size, autoload
FROM wp_options
WHERE autoload = 'yes'
ORDER BY option_size DESC
LIMIT 20;
Deze query toont de 20 grootste opties die als autoload zijn gemarkeerd. Grote en automatisch geladen opties zijn belangrijke factoren die direct invloed hebben op de TTFB-tijd. Daarnaast kan de totale grootte van autoloaded data worden berekend met de volgende query:
SELECT SUM(LENGTH(option_value)) AS total_autoload_size
FROM wp_options
WHERE autoload = 'yes';
Deze informatie helpt je om potentiële prestatieknelpunten in de wp_options-tabel te begrijpen.
Tools en plugins om prestatieproblemen te detecteren
Voor een gedetailleerdere analyse en eenvoudige interventie bij problemen in de wp_options-tabel kunnen de volgende tools en plugins worden aanbevolen:
- Query Monitor: Een krachtige plugin die WordPress-prestaties monitort en databasequery's in detail weergeeft. Vooral nuttig om trage query's en autoloaded opties te identificeren.
- WP-Optimize: Een populaire tool die databaseopschoning en optimalisatie automatiseert. Kan onnodige wp_options-records opsporen en verwijderen.
- Advanced Database Cleaner: Een andere effectieve plugin die de WordPress-database scant en veilig onnodige data verwijdert.
Met deze tools kun je uitgebreide informatie verkrijgen over de duur van databasequery's, de omvang van autoloaded data en de status van tijdelijke gegevens.
Symptomen van wp_options-bloat
Er zijn enkele duidelijke signalen van een opgeblazen wp_options-tabel die wijzen op vertragingen en hoge TTFB-waarden:
- Trage admin-omgeving: Als het WordPress-beheerpanel traag opent, kunnen autoloaded opties of tijdelijke data de databasequery's vertragen.
- Toename in serverresponstijd: Als het hostingpaneel of prestatiehulpmiddelen een stijging in responstijd laten zien, kan dit duiden op een trage database.
- Hoge TTFB-metingen: Een hoge TTFB-score in tools zoals Google PageSpeed Insights, GTmetrix of WebPageTest kan worden toegeschreven aan een overbelaste wp_options-tabel.
Praktijkvoorbeelden en resultaten
Veel WordPress-sites hebben na het opschonen van de wp_options-tabel aanzienlijke prestatieverbeteringen ervaren. Zo heeft een nieuwssite na het verwijderen van autoloaded opties en onnodige tijdelijke data de TTFB-waarde verlaagd van 800 ms naar 300 ms. Dit verbeterde de laadsnelheid van pagina's en de gebruikerservaring aanzienlijk.
In een ander voorbeeld heeft een e-commerce site oude plugingegevens uit de wp_options-tabel verwijderd, waardoor de serverresponstijd met de helft afnam en de SEO-scores stegen. Dit soort succesverhalen onderstreept hoe cruciaal het is om de wp_options-tabel regelmatig te controleren en te optimaliseren.
Het correct en tijdig identificeren van problemen in de wp_options-tabel is essentieel om de TTFB te verlagen en de prestaties van je WordPress-site te verbeteren. Zo kun je zowel je bezoekers snellere pagina’s bieden als je zichtbaarheid in zoekmachines versterken.

Effectieve strategieën voor het opschonen en optimaliseren van de wp_options-tabel om TTFB te verminderen
Het opschonen van onnodige gegevens in de wp_options-tabel is een van de meest effectieve methoden om de WordPress-prestaties te verbeteren en TTFB-tijden te verlagen. Het is echter cruciaal om tijdens dit proces voorzichtig te zijn en de juiste stappen te volgen om de stabiliteit en functionaliteit van je site te behouden.
Stapsgewijze opschoning van onnodige autoloaded opties
Maak een back-up van je database: Voordat je begint met opschonen, is het essentieel om een volledige back-up te maken. Zo kun je je site herstellen als er per ongeluk kritieke gegevens worden verwijderd. PhpMyAdmin, het hosting controlepaneel of betrouwbare back-upplugins zijn hiervoor geschikt.
Bekijk de lijst met autoloaded opties: Analyseer de autoloaded gegevens die je eerder met SQL-queries hebt verkregen. Focus vooral op grote en overbodige opties. Bijvoorbeeld, overgebleven records van ongebruikte plugins of instellingen van oude thema’s kunnen hier voorkomen.
Verwijder onnodige autoload opties veilig: Verwijder alleen opties waarvan je zeker weet dat ze overbodig zijn. Dit kan handmatig via phpMyAdmin of met de volgende SQL-query:
DELETE FROM wp_options WHERE option_name = 'onnodige_option_naam';
Wijzig autoload-instelling naar “no”: Soms is het riskant om bepaalde opties volledig te verwijderen. In dat geval kun je de autoload-waarde van ‘yes’ naar ‘no’ wijzigen, zodat deze gegevens niet automatisch worden geladen en de querytijd wordt verminderd.
Transient gegevens beheren en verwijderen
Transient gegevens zijn tijdelijke records die WordPress gebruikt voor prestatieverbeteringen en die na een bepaalde tijd automatisch verwijderd moeten worden. Soms blijven deze gegevens echter in de database staan en blazen ze de wp_options-tabel op.
Transient gegevens opsporen: Via PhpMyAdmin of WP-CLI kun je met de volgende query verlopen transient gegevens eenvoudig vinden:
SELECT option_name FROM wp_options WHERE option_name LIKE '_transient_%' AND option_value < NOW();
Opschonen: Verlopen of onnodige transient gegevens kunnen worden verwijderd met plugins zoals WP-Optimize. Ook handmatig via SQL is mogelijk:
DELETE FROM wp_options WHERE option_name LIKE '_transient_%';
Deze stappen helpen de onnodige belasting door tijdelijke gegevens te verwijderen en dragen bij aan een lagere TTFB.
Database back-up en beveiligingsmaatregelen
Voordat je met optimalisaties begint, is het maken van een databaseback-up de belangrijkste bescherming tegen dataverlies. Dit kan eenvoudig via het WordPress-beheer, het controlepaneel van je hostingprovider of populaire back-upplugins zoals UpdraftPlus.
Na het maken van een back-up kun je de effecten van wijzigingen nauwlettend volgen en indien nodig terugdraaien. Dit zorgt ervoor dat je prestaties verbetert zonder de functionaliteit van je site in gevaar te brengen.
wp_options opschonen met SQL-queries en plugins
Voor het optimaliseren van de wp_options-tabel kun je zowel SQL-queries als plugins gebruiken. SQL-queries bieden snelle en effectieve oplossingen voor technisch onderlegde gebruikers, maar onjuiste queries kunnen schade aanrichten.
Plugins bieden een gebruiksvriendelijke interface voor automatische opschoning en optimalisatie. Aanbevolen plugins zijn onder andere:
- WP-Optimize: Biedt automatische en handmatige databaseopschoning, verwijdert onnodige opties en transient gegevens.
- Advanced Database Cleaner: Effectief in het opsporen en verwijderen van overbodige wp_options-records en biedt ook planning voor regelmatig onderhoud.
Deze tools maken databaseoptimalisatie eenvoudiger en minimaliseren fouten.
Tips om toekomstige wp_options-opblazing te voorkomen
- Controleer plugins en thema’s: Verwijder ongebruikte of slechte plugins om te voorkomen dat onnodige wp_options zich ophopen.
- Beheer autoload-instellingen: Controleer autoload-instellingen bij nieuwe plugins en thema’s om te voorkomen dat onnodige gegevens automatisch worden geladen.
- Plan regelmatige opschoningsroutines: Stel wekelijkse of maandelijkse onderhoudsbeurten in om transient en andere overbodige records te verwijderen.
- Optimaliseer datagrootte: Vereenvoudig grote opties of gebruik alternatieve opslagmethoden om de groei van de wp_options-tabel te beperken.
Deze strategieën zorgen ervoor dat de wp_options-tabel gezond blijft en de TTFB laag wordt gehouden.
Optimaliseren van de grootte van autoloaded data en opschoningsfrequentie
Het beperken van de grootte van autoloaded opties is een directe manier om de snelheid van je WordPress-site te verhogen. Het markeren van grote, onnodige gegevens als autoload betekent extra queries bij elke paginalaad en beïnvloedt TTFB negatief. Daarom is het belangrijk om:
- Grote gegevens uit autoload te verwijderen,
- Alleen veelgebruikte basisinstellingen als autoload te laten staan,
- Regelmatig op te schonen door transient gegevens en oude records te verwijderen,
om zo de prestaties op lange termijn te behouden.
Het optimaliseren van de wp_options-tabel biedt aanzienlijke voordelen voor zowel snelheid als SEO van je WordPress-site. Het zorgvuldig uitvoeren van deze stappen heeft een belangrijke impact op het verlagen van TTFB en het verbeteren van de gebruikerservaring.
Het benutten van wp_options-tabeloptimalisatie als onderdeel van een holistische WordPress-databaseprestatiestrategie
WordPress database-optimalisatie moet niet beperkt blijven tot het opschonen van de wp_options-tabel. Om de prestatieverbetering te maximaliseren, moet het optimaliseren van deze tabel geïntegreerd worden met andere databaseonderhoudstaken. Zo is het mogelijk om de snelheid van je WordPress-site als geheel te verbeteren en TTFB-tijden te minimaliseren.
Integratie met andere databaseoptimalisatietechnieken
Naast het opschonen van de wp_options-tabel is het belangrijk om ook andere overbodige gegevens in de database te verwijderen. Bijvoorbeeld:
- Dubbele of oude postrevisies: WordPress slaat elke wijziging op en deze revisies blazen de database na verloop van tijd op. Het opschonen hiervan vermindert de querytijden.
- Spam en goedkeuringswachtende reacties: Deze records nemen onnodig ruimte in en kunnen queries vertragen.
- Ongebruikte tijdelijke tabellen en metadata: Soms blijven deze gegevens achter na het verwijderen van plugins en verlagen ze de databaseprestaties.
Het regelmatig opschonen van deze records, gecombineerd met de optimalisatie van de wp_options-tabel, verbetert de algehele gezondheid en prestaties van je WordPress-database aanzienlijk.
Database-optimalisatie combineren met caching-oplossingen
Het optimaliseren van de wp_options-tabel levert in combinatie met caching-systemen nog effectievere resultaten op bij het verlagen van TTFB. Caching vermindert het aantal databasequeries en versnelt zo de responstijd van de server. Populaire caching-oplossingen zijn:
- Object Cache: Houdt vaak opgevraagde data in het geheugen om queries te versnellen.
- Page Cache: Cachet volledige pagina-inhoud om de afhankelijkheid van de database te verminderen.
- CDN-integratie: Content Delivery Networks serveren statische bestanden snel en verlichten de serverbelasting.
Het opschonen van wp_options zorgt ervoor dat de cachemechanismen efficiënter werken, omdat de gecachte data actueel en vrij van onnodige informatie is.
De rol van hostingomgeving en serverconfiguratie
De queryprestaties van de wp_options-tabel hangen niet alleen af van de database-structuur, maar ook sterk van de hostingomgeving en serverconfiguratie. Een goed geconfigureerde server verwerkt databasequeries snel en verlaagt zo de TTFB-waarden.
Belangrijke factoren zijn:
- Prestaties van de databaseserver: De versie en configuratie van MySQL/MariaDB beïnvloeden direct de snelheid van queries.
- Serverresources: Voldoende RAM en CPU-kracht zorgen voor snelle databasebewerkingen.
- PHP-versie: Nieuwere PHP-versies dragen bij aan snellere werking van WordPress.
- Databasecaching: Mechanismen zoals query cache verkorten de responstijden van queries.
Het optimaliseren van deze componenten ondersteunt de prestatieverbetering van de wp_options-tabel en helpt TTFB tot een minimum te beperken.
Continu monitoren van databasegezondheid en TTFB-prestaties
Optimalisatie van de wp_options-tabel is geen eenmalige actie; het vereist regelmatige monitoring en onderhoud. Het is belangrijk om met prestatiebewakingstools de TTFB-waarden en databasegezondheid van je site continu in de gaten te houden.
Aanbevolen methoden zijn:
- Google PageSpeed Insights en GTmetrix: Bieden gedetailleerde rapporten over TTFB en laadsnelheden.
- Query Monitor-plugin: Analyseert databasequeries realtime en detecteert trage queries.
- Prestatiepanelen van je hostingprovider: Geven inzicht in serverresponstijden en resourcegebruik.
Met deze tools kun je potentiële problemen in de wp_options-tabel vroegtijdig opsporen en aanpakken. Zo houd je de snelheid en SEO-prestaties van je WordPress-site duurzaam op peil.
Langdurige site snelheid en SEO-doelen met regelmatige wp_options-onderhoud
Het regelmatig optimaliseren van de wp_options-tabel levert niet alleen kortetermijnprestatiewinst op, maar is ook een cruciale strategie om de SEO-prestaties van je site te verbeteren en de gebruikerservaring continu te optimaliseren.

- Lage TTFB wordt positief beoordeeld door zoekmachines en is een rankingfactor.
- Snelle sites verhogen de verblijftijd van bezoekers en verlagen het bouncepercentage.
- Regelmatig onderhoud voorkomt onverwachte prestatieproblemen en verhoogt de betrouwbaarheid van je site.
Daarom is het opnemen van wp_options-tabeloptimalisatie als een vast onderdeel van je databaseonderhoud de slimste aanpak voor het duurzame succes van je WordPress-site.
Best Practices en Tools voor Duurzame Gezondheid van de wp_options-tabel om Lage TTFB te Behouden
Het gezond houden van de wp_options-tabel en het laag houden van TTFB vereist regelmatig onderhoud. Er zijn verschillende tools en best practices beschikbaar om dit proces te vergemakkelijken en te automatiseren.
Aanbevolen Plugins voor Automatische Opschoning en Optimalisatie
- WP-Optimize: Voert regelmatige databaseopschoning uit en verwijdert automatisch onnodige gegevens uit de wp_options-tabel.
- Advanced Database Cleaner: Optimaliseert de wp_options-tabel en andere databasegebieden met aanpasbare planningsopties.
- Transient Cleaner: Verwijdert regelmatig verlopen transient-gegevens om de databasebelasting te verminderen.
Deze plugins zorgen ervoor dat je wp_options-tabel gezond blijft zonder technische kennis. Daarnaast kan de prestatie van je database continu op een hoog niveau worden gehouden door periodiek onderhoud.